How they compare
Republic of Korea currently reports 0.8% against 0.8% in Ireland,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Ireland ahead.
Ireland ranks 157th and Republic of Korea ranks 155th of 212 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Ireland averaged higher in 2 and Republic of Korea in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ireland | Republic of Korea |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 15.1% | 1.1% | 13.9% | Ireland |
| 2010s | 27.1% | 0.7% | 26.4% | Ireland |
| 2020s | -1.5% | 1.0% | 2.5% | Republic of Korea |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
